SUMMARY:Talk Saves Lives: An Introduction to Suicide Prevention in the Construction Industry
DESCRIPTION:Join AGC's Safety Committee for Talk Saves Lives: An Introduction to Suicide Prevention in the Construction Industry\, a powerful\, practical session designed specifically for our industry.This session is built specifically for construction professionals and front-line supervisors. It will be delivered by a trusted voice within the industry. You'll walk away with actionable tools\, a better understanding of how to recognize when someone may be struggling\, and ways to help foster a jobsite culture where it's okay to speak up and seek support.Adapted from the American Foundation for Suicide Prevention's flagship education program\, this training takes a closer look at the realities facing construction workers\, including key risk factors\, warning signs\, and what we can do to support one another and prevent suicide.\n\nWe'll wrap with Q&A and information on how to get connected with additional resources\, including the Hard Hat Courage campaign.This is an important conversation for our industry\, and one that can make a real difference. We hope you'll join us.
